Overview
Principal Design Engineer – responsible for leading and managing all engineering activities for transmission substation projects from early engagement through to as-built, with a focus on HV, EHV and AIS & GIS design and construction.
Key Responsibilities- Lead engineering activities and ensure compliance with Linxon standards, QA/QC, HSSE, and project specifications.
- Technical lead for large and complex EHV/HV Substation projects in the UK.
- Supervise, coordinate, and provide guidance to local and remote engineering teams, partners, sub‑suppliers and external suppliers.
- Coordinate interfaces between construction planning, steel structure engineering, protection and control systems, auxiliary power systems and all equipment suppliers.
- Lead technical discussions with customers and suppliers, address site queries and deliver as-built documentation.
- Manage engineering budget, schedule, forecast, risk, change and technical claims.
- Develop and deliver technical solutions – single line diagrams, layouts, detailed drawings, specifications, calculations, cost estimates, and tender support.
- Review supplier designs, attend factory and site tests, and provide technical support throughout the project life cycle.
- Travel 25% of the time (domestic and international) and support hybrid working arrangements.
-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Electrical Engineering or equivalent.
- Proven experience in transmission substation engineering, detailed design, tender processes, and site support.
- Knowledge of SSEN, SPEN requirements and industry standards.
- Chartered Engineer (CEng) status or working towards it.
- Fluency in English – written and spoken.
- Strong communication and team working in a multi‑cultural environment.
- Expertise in substation design, layouts, primary design & calculations, grounding, lightning, steel design, transformers, HV & MV switch gear, system studies, single line diagrams, CT/VT calculations, auxiliary power systems, power cables, and protection & control systems.
- Knowledge of installation and commissioning.
- Proficiency in MS Office, Micro Station and AutoCAD.
- Result‑oriented, proactive approach to problem solving and technical innovation.
